仕様

属性
Part Status Obsolete
Number of Bits 12
Number of D / A Converters 8
Settling Time 10µs
Output Type Voltage - Buffered
Differential Output No
Data Interface Parallel
Reference Type External
Voltage - Supply, Analog 2.5V ~ 5.5V
Voltage - Supply, Digital 2.5V ~ 5.5V
INL / DNL (LSB) ±2, ±0.2
Architecture String DAC
Operating Temperature -40°C ~ 105°C
Package / Case 38-TFSOP (0.173", 4.40mm Width)
Supplier Device Package 38-TSSOP
Mounting Type Surface Mount
Base Product Number AD5348
